Show NOTICE TO CONTRACTORS SEALED proposals will be received by the Alpine School District for an addition to the High School at Pleasant Grove, Utah County, State of Utah. There will be a separate bid for the general contract and one for the heating and plumbing. Plans and specifications may be obtained from the School Board Office, or from the Architect, Joseph Nelson. Each bid must be accompanied by a certified check equal to five per cent (ro) of the accompanying bid, and made payable to the Alpine School District, said hid to be a guarantee of good faith on the part of contractor, contract-or, and should he be awarded the contract, con-tract, that he will, within ten (10) days furnish a Sureity Bond, as provided by law, otherwise the amount of his check to be forfeit to (he School District, and that they may enter into such other and further agreements as they may see fit. Bids will be opened at the office of the Alpine School Board, at American Fork, Utah County, Utah, on the 3rd day of June, A. D. 1929, (June 3, 1929) at five (5) o'clock P. M., and the Board reserves' the right to reject any or all bids. First Publication May 25, 1929. Last Publication June 1, 1929. |
